Ryaan1205 Posted January 27, 2011 Posted January 27, 2011 hey guys, just replaced my motherboard, and i need too 'reactivate' windows. i have rang 'microsoft' up, and it put me through too a automated service, i gave them the code, and said i was pirating apparently, what should i do? really annoying as i have bascially wasted 60 pounds, and i cant even find a number for microsoft to talk to a proper person! :@ thanks guys Quote
Shaunno Posted January 27, 2011 Posted January 27, 2011 Well when I replaced my mobo and CPU I had to reactivate Windows by ringing them up I had to give the automated service my serial number and the machine gave me a 25 digit code back to type into Windows and it worked ok for me, are you sure you gave the correct serial and typed the correct code back into Windows. Shaunno Posted January 27, 2011 Posted January 27, 2011 even if you reformat you will have to active it because your hardware ID has changed since you replaced some major parts thats why you have to do it in the first place because the software thinks your trying to install it on more than one machine Quote
Thrill Posted January 27, 2011 Posted January 27, 2011 Re-formatting isn't going to help. I would definitely look to start contacting Microsoft saying you've upgrade your motherboard and now you're serial isn't working. If you've paid for Windows, then you surely are entitled to it.
